-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 Hi, The ruby-gnome stuff is due for an update. I've got a patch here: http://people.freebsd.org/~swills/ruby_gnome_0.90.9_update.diff.txt Not included in that diff is the removal of these ports: devel/ruby-gconf2 devel/ruby-gnomevfs devel/ruby-libglade2 graphics/ruby-libart2 print/ruby-gnomeprint www/ruby-gtkhtml2 x11-toolkits/ruby-gnomeprintui x11-toolkits/ruby-gtkglext x11-toolkits/ruby-panelapplet x11/ruby-gnome2 These are to be removed because these modules are no longer included in the upstream ruby-gnome distribution. Of those, these have dependencies: devel/ruby-gconf2 devel/ruby-libglade2 x11/ruby-gnome2 x11-toolkits/ruby-panelapplet Dependents include: audio/ruby-musicextras x11-themes/gnome-splashscreen-manager x11-themes/gnome-art science/gave japanese/gsuica deskutils/sshmenu What should happen with these dependencies? Technically I can go ahead and update the ruby-gnome dependencies, but that will break these ports. Based on what I know, at best they will have to be rewritten and at worst they will go away completely since the functionality they rely on won't be supported by Gnome any more.
